As shown in fig. 1, 2 and 3, an auxiliary device for catching volleyball for sports volleyball teaching according to an embodiment of the present invention includes a supporting frame 1, wheels are mounted at the bottom of the supporting frame 1 for easy movement, a horizontal supporting plate 2 is fixedly disposed on the supporting frame 1, a movable plate 4 is disposed on the supporting plate 2 through a sliding member 3, a driving mechanism 5 for driving the movable plate 4 to move back and forth is disposed on the supporting plate 2, a launching tube 6 is hinged to the movable plate 4, the launching tube 6 forms an included angle with the movable plate 4, an adjusting mechanism 7 is disposed on the movable plate 4, the adjusting mechanism 7 is used for adjusting the launching tube 6 to rotate back and forth around the hinged point, a launching mechanism 8 for pushing volleyball out of the launching tube 6 is disposed on the supporting frame 1, in this embodiment, volleyball is placed in the launching tube 6 by disposing the supporting plate 2 on the supporting frame 1, the driving mechanism 5 is activated, under slider 3's effect for fly leaf 4 round trip movement, start adjustment mechanism 7 simultaneously, adjust launch tube 6 and rotate around the pin joint and adjust the angle between launch tube 6 and fly leaf 4, start launching mechanism 8 afterwards, launch the volleyball in the launch tube 6, to sum up, the sports volleyball teaching of our design is with detaining ball auxiliary assembly, and the angle of adjustable launch tube 6 and not fixed in a position can random emission, utilizes the multi-angle to take exercise volleyball sportsman in order to reach sportsman's requirement, improves the effect of taking exercise.
As shown in fig. 1, in some embodiments, the sliding member 3 includes a T-shaped groove 31 formed on the supporting plate 2, the T-shaped groove 31 extends along the length direction of the supporting plate 2, a T-shaped block 32 adapted to the T-shaped groove 31 is disposed on the movable plate 4, in this embodiment, the T-shaped block 32 can slide in the T-shaped groove 31, and the movable plate 4 can be supported by the sliding member 3, so as to improve the stability of the movable plate 4, and at the same time, can play a role in guiding so that the movable plate 4 can move along the same direction.
As shown in fig. 1, in some embodiments, the driving mechanism 5 includes a motor 51 installed on the supporting plate 2, an output shaft of the motor 51 is connected with a first threaded rod 52 installed on the supporting plate 2, the first threaded rod 52 penetrates through the movable plate 4, in this embodiment, the motor 51 is started, the first threaded rod 52 is driven by the rotation of the output shaft of the motor 51, the movable plate 4 moves back and forth under the guidance of the sliding member 3, the driving mechanism 5 provides a driving source, the device is powered, the position in the horizontal direction can be changed, rather than being fixed at a position, and the exercise effect is improved.
As shown in fig. 1, in some embodiments, the adjusting mechanism 7 includes a second threaded rod 71 bearing-mounted on the movable plate 4, the second threaded rod 71 is disposed on the movable plate 4 perpendicularly to the first threaded rod 52, a sliding block 72 is threadedly connected to the second threaded rod 71, the second threaded rod 71 is threaded through the sliding block 72, a connecting rod 73 is hinged to the sliding block 72, the other end of the connecting rod 73 is hinged to the launching tube 6, a transmission mechanism 9 is disposed on the bearing plate 2, the transmission mechanism 9 is used for driving the second threaded rod 71 to rotate, in this embodiment, the transmission mechanism 9 movably drives the second threaded rod 71 to rotate, the slider 72 moves back and forth to drive the connecting rod 73 to rotate, so as to force the launching tube 6 to change the angle between the launching tube 6 and the movable plate 4, the adjusting mechanism 7 can adjust the angle of the launching tube 6 in the vertical direction, adjust the launching angle, facilitate the exercise of athletes, improve the exercise effect,
as shown in fig. 1, in some embodiments, the transmission mechanism 9 includes a rack 91 fixed on the supporting plate 2, the rack 91 is disposed along the length direction of the first threaded rod 52, a gear 92 adapted to the rack 91 is fixedly sleeved on the second threaded rod 71, in this embodiment, when the movable plate 4 moves back and forth, the device on the movable plate 4 can move back and forth together, under the action of the rack 91, the gear 92 can rotate, so that the second threaded rod 71 rotates, the number of the motors 51 can be reduced by the arrangement of the transmission mechanism 9, the same driving source is utilized, energy is saved, and the horizontal position of the launching tube 6 and the vertical angle of the launching tube 6 are synchronously adjusted.
As shown in fig. 2 and 3, in some embodiments, the launching mechanism 8 includes an impact cylinder 81 installed at the end of the launching tube 6, the output end of the impact cylinder 81 is connected with a push plate 82 adapted to the launching tube 6, in this embodiment, the impact cylinder 81 is randomly started, so that the push plate 82 obtains thrust to extrude and launch volleyballs in the launching tube 6 for training of athletes, and the launching mechanism 8 is arranged to replace manual toss with machines, thereby saving physical strength, and being capable of randomly launching and training the reaction of athletes.
As shown in figure 1, in some embodiments, the launching tube 6 is provided with a conical funnel 61 communicated with the launching tube 6, a plurality of volleyballs can be placed in the conical funnel 61, in the present embodiment, after one volleyball is launched, the volleyball can fall into the launching tube 6 from the conical funnel 61 to prepare for next launching, the conical funnel 61 can provide a plurality of volleyballs to be launched continuously, time is saved, the exercise intensity is improved, and athletes are effectively exercised.
